fix: update ClickHouse DDL files with new column names instead of ALTER RENAME
ClickHouse can't rename columns that are part of ORDER BY keys.
Updated V1-V8 DDL files directly with new column names (instance_id,
application_id) and removed V9 migration. Wipe ClickHouse and restart.

CREATE TABLE IF NOT EXISTS logs (
tenant_id LowCardinality(String) DEFAULT 'default',
timestamp DateTime64(3),
application LowCardinality(String),
instance_id LowCardinality(String),
level LowCardinality(String),
logger_name LowCardinality(String) DEFAULT '',
message String,
thread_name LowCardinality(String) DEFAULT '',
stack_trace String DEFAULT '',
exchange_id String DEFAULT '',
mdc Map(String, String) DEFAULT map(),
INDEX idx_msg message TYPE ngrambf_v1(3, 256, 2, 0) GRANULARITY 4,
INDEX idx_stack stack_trace TYPE ngrambf_v1(3, 256, 2, 0) GRANULARITY 4,
INDEX idx_level level TYPE set(10) GRANULARITY 1
)
ENGINE = MergeTree()
PARTITION BY (tenant_id, toYYYYMM(timestamp))
ORDER BY (tenant_id, application, timestamp)
TTL toDateTime(timestamp) + INTERVAL 365 DAY DELETE
SETTINGS index_granularity = 8192;
